Recognizing Low-VOC Paints



When you pick low-VOC paints, you're opting for a product that discharges fewer volatile natural compounds, which can be harmful to both your wellness and the setting.


VOCs are chemicals found in numerous paint products that can vaporize right into the air and contribute to interior air pollution. By choosing low-VOC options, you're minimizing the number of these exhausts, making your space more secure.

Low-VOC paints normally contain 50 grams per liter or fewer VOCs, compared to traditional paints that can contain up to 250 grams per litre. This indicates that when you paint your home with low-VOC items, you're not just deciding for visual appeals; you're also taking a step towards a healthier indoor environment.

An additional problem is the drying out time. Low-VOC paints commonly take longer to dry than their high-VOC equivalents, which can prolong your project timeline. If you get on a tight timetable, this could be a disadvantage to think about.

You need to likewise understand that low-VOC paints can in some cases have a different finish or structure. If you're going for a details aesthetic, make sure to test examples to make certain the result satisfies your expectations.

Last but not least, while low-VOC paints are generally more secure, they can still send out some fumes. Proper ventilation is essential throughout and after application, so be prepared to air out your area successfully.
